Contractors to Save Money with New Rules for Expenses and Subsistence

The government announced in its 2014 Budget that the rules underlying the taxation of travel and subsidence expenses will be reviewed. This is in response to the Office of Tax Simplification’s (OTS) report from January 2014 on the tax treatment of employee benefits and the expenses Review of employee benefits and expenses: second report.

As agreed, the Travel and Subsistence Review was started by the government on 31 July 2014.

This consultation is partly prompted by the need to develop a system better suited to contractors and other flexible workers. This system should be one that will entail new and simpler rules governing expenses and subsistence for contractors.

However, it is unlikely that any changes to the existing regime will happen until after 2015.

“Given the scope of the review and the complexity of devising a new set of rules, the government expects that this will be a longer-term piece of work, and therefore has no plan to legislate for these new rules in the remainder of the current parliament.” the Treasury said.
